Bennett Named IU Athlete of the Week
12/19/2005 12:00:00 AM | General
Dec. 19, 2005
BLOOMINGTON, Ind. - On a weekly basis, IUHOOSIERS.com will recognize the top performances in Hoosier Athletics by selecting an IU Athlete of the Week. For the week ending Dec. 18, sophomore wrestler Marc Bennett garnered the distinction.
Bennett helped lead the Hoosiers to a perfect 3-0 record at the FITE Duals in Park Forrest, Ill. Indiana quickly disposed of Southern Illinois-Edwardsville, 28-9, before taking on 21st-ranked Northern Illinois. IU never trailed in the dual and easily handed the Huskies a 28-9 defeat. To finish off the weekend, the Hoosiers disposed of Wisconsin-Whitewater, 45-4.
Bennett's individual efforts included sweeping the competition at 174 pounds in commanding fashion. The Martinsville, Ind., native dismissed Southern Illinois-Edwardsville's Chris Midgett (2:30) and Wisconsin-Whitewater's Scott Moe (3:32) by fall. Against NIU's 19th-ranked Danny Burke, Bennett needed extra periods before using a takedown to defeat Burke 9-7 in the first overtime period. The sophomore's win marked his first victory over a ranked opponent this season.
On the year, Bennett has posted four falls and two major decisions and is 1-2 against ranked opponents. Bennett has tallied 18 dual points, a 4-1 dual record and moved to 8-4 overall on the season.
Bennett earned the IU Athlete of the Week honor and is recognized along with freshman forward Whitney Thomas of women's basketball in this week's Hoosier honor roll.
